Exploring Trastevere Local Brands

Overview and purpose

In Trastevere, business is not only strategy. It is atmosphere, story, and identity woven into the streets.

Exploring Trastevere Local Brands is a two hour immersive experience designed for anyone curious about entrepreneurship, positioning, and brand storytelling in one of Rome’s most characteristic districts. Here, tradition meets tourism, authenticity meets adaptation, and every storefront becomes a case study in how identity turns into value.

Through guided reflection and structured observation, participants learn to decode how local ventures balance heritage, creativity, and commercial sustainability in a highly competitive environment.

location

Rome, Italy. This experience takes place outdoors in the Trastevere district, including Piazza Santa Maria in Trastevere, Via della Lungaretta, Via del Moro, and the Piazza Trilussa area.

Duration and Daily Schedule

Total: 2 hours

 

1) Founder Activation and District Introduction

Duration: 30 minutes

Location: Piazza Santa Maria in Trastevere

Activity: Introduction to Trastevere as a living entrepreneurial ecosystem, Founder One Line Challenge, and the Five Why Purpose Drill in pairs.

 

2) Business and Customer Analysis Lab

Duration: 30 minutes

Location: Via della Lungaretta and Via del Moro

Activity: Observation of artisan shops and independent ventures, defining customer profiles through direct observation of real behavior, identification of positioning, pricing strategy, and target audience.

 

3) Live Brand Decoding Route

Duration: 30 minutes

Location: Streets toward Piazza Trilussa

Activity: Silent market observation sprint, visual brand decoding of selected businesses, and analysis of authenticity versus tourist driven positioning.

 

4) Reflection, Concept Creation and Entrepreneurial Expression

Duration: 30 minutes

Location: Piazza Trilussa

Activity: Guided reflection on insights gathered, development of a realistic business idea suited to the district, definition of mission, target audience, value proposition, and logo direction, followed by a short walking pitch and group feedback.
